Histórico de mensagens sobre js

EXIBINDO CONVERSAS RECENTES:

Texto: js
# pix
Avatar discord do usuario ocndeo

ocndeo

Meu cliente ele testa tanto pelo vue.js tanto pelo react native ai sempre da esse erro e eu faço o teste nas mesmas plataformas e funciona.

# cartões
Avatar discord do usuario felipithstdr

felipithstdr

Ver Respostas

sim o layout, digo referente layout da cobranca, "checkout form"

sobre sdk - ok entendido

caso nao tenha o layout referente a esse "checkout form", digo assim, qual seria o nome referente, que eu passaria ao json, que se refere a quantidade de vezes de parcelas?

# cartões
Avatar discord do usuario igor_efi

igor_efi

Ver Respostas

Quanto ao layout, você se refere ao layout da cobrança, como o formato do boleto, ou ao layout da página de pagamento? Não ficou muito claro para mim.
Sim, você pode utilizar a SDK de TypeScript disponível em: SDK TypeScript.
Poderia fornecer mais detalhes sobre a sua pergunta: "Caso não tenha layout pronto, como fica o parâmetro referente à quantidade de vezes do cliente no JSON?"?

# pix
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Oi, bom dia! Como vai?
Se você usar o método pixSplitConfig, não precisa passar o params, pois o id é gerado automaticamente pela nossa API.

E usando o método pixSplitConfigId, deve passar o params da seguinte forma:

js
let params = {
id: ${makeid(27)}
}

# cartões
Avatar discord do usuario felipithstdr

felipithstdr

Ver Respostas

1- Sobre os pagamentos (pix, cartao e boleto), a criacao do layout fica por conta do desenvolvedor, ou existe ja um layout pronto pra utilizar?

2 - Pra baixar a sdk, como estou usando next.js (typescript), baixo somente a de TS?

3 - Caso nao tenha layout pronto, como que fica dai o parametro, referente a quantidade de vezes do client no json?

# cartões
Avatar discord do usuario felipithstdr

felipithstdr

Ver Respostas

Boa tarde, queria tirar umas duvidas, sobre desenvolvimento da API, para next.js (typescript), alguem disponivel?

# pix
Avatar discord do usuario errorzadaa

errorzadaa

Ver Respostas

js
let body = {
"descricao": "Split Pagamentos",
"lancamento": {
"imediato": true
},
"split": {
"divisaoTarifa": "assumir_total",
"minhaParte": {
"tipo": "porcentagem",
"valor": "2.00"
},
"repasses": [
{
"tipo": "porcentagem",
"valor": "98.00",
"favorecido": {
"cpf": "",
"conta": ""
}
},
]
}
}
body

# pix
Avatar discord do usuario jessica_efi

jessica_efi

Ver Respostas

Boa tarde @schulzthegoat. Ainda não temos os exemplos de split Pix na sdk de node, porém as rotas ja estão no arquivo constants.js. Vamos atualizar a nossa sdk, so não consigo te dar uma previsao. Mas como as rotas ja estao na sdk, você pode criar os exemplos.

# cartões
Avatar discord do usuario lucasfelipes23

lucasfelipes23

Ver Respostas

curl --location 'https://cobrancas-h.api.efipay.com.br/v1/charge/one-step' \
--header 'Authorization: token' \
--header 'Content-Type: application/json' \
--data-raw '{
"items": [
{
"name": "Meu Produto",
"value": 1000,
"amount": 1
}
],
"payment": {
"credit_card": {
"customer": {
"name": "Gorbadoc Oldbuck",
"cpf": "94271564656",
"email": "[email protected]",
"birth": "1990-08-29",
"phone_number": "5144916523"
},
"installments": 1,
"payment_token": "9621af918d06297342bba69fa32e65dbc43542c0",
"billing_address": {
"street": "Avenida Juscelino Kubitschek",
"number": "909",
"neighborhood": "Bauxita",
"zipcode": "35400000",
"city": "Ouro Preto",
"complement": "",
"state": "MG"
}
}
}
}'

# freelancer
Avatar discord do usuario aozora_d

aozora_d

Hello everyone, everything good?
I am an experienced web developer with a passion for creating visually stunning and highly functional websites and web applications.
I've been working as a Full stack Developer for over 5 years.

I am an extremely skilled professional in developing websites and web applications, focusing on the user experience and also on the responsiveness of my projects.

[UI/UX, Javascript, React, Next.js, NodeJS, NestJS, Python/Django, AI chatbot integration, AI assets(audio, image...) generate].
Portfolio : https://www.aozora-developer.com/

I am available to work on project and ready to discuss further.
Thanks.

# pix
Avatar discord do usuario gabreudev

gabreudev

Ver Respostas

java.security.NoSuchAlgorithmException: Error constructing implementation (algorithm: Default, provider: SunJSSE, class: sun.security.ssl.SSLContextImpl$DefaultSSLContext

# mercado-pagamentos
Avatar discord do usuario rubenskuhl

rubenskuhl

O resumo é que vai dar para entender melhor quando sair a especificação da Jornada Sem Redirecionamento (JSR) do OpenFinance, prevista para o próximo dia 31.

# cartões
Avatar discord do usuario marcelocaser

marcelocaser

try {
window.EfiJs.CreditCard
.setAccount('Identificador_de_conta_aqui')
.setEnvironment('production') // 'production' or 'sandbox'
.setCreditCardData({
brand: 'visa',
number: '4485785674290087',
cvv: '123',
expirationMonth: '05',
expirationYear: '2029',
reuse: false
})
.getPaymentToken()
.then(data => {
const payment_token = data.payment_token;
const card_mask = data.card_mask;

console.log('payment_token', payment_token);
console.log('card_mask', card_mask);
}).catch(err => {
console.log('Código: ', err.code);
console.log('Nome: ', err.error);
console.log('Mensagem: ', err.error_description);
});
} catch (error) {
console.log('Código: ', error.code);
console.log('Nome: ', error.error);
console.log('Mensagem: ', error.error_description);
}

# pix
Avatar discord do usuario marcosvinicius0759

marcosvinicius0759


function resposta($status, $mensagem, $dados)
{
$resposta['status'] = $status;
$resposta['mensagem'] = $mensagem;
$resposta['dados'] = $dados;
$json_resposta = '

' . json_encode($resposta, JSON_PRETTY_PRINT | JSON_UNESCAPED_UNICODE | JSON_UNESCAPED_SLASHES) . '
';

header("HTTP/1.1 " . $status);
echo $json_resposta;
}

function salvar($dados)
{
// Crie um arquivo .;json para salvar as informações
$nomeArquivo = './dados.json';
$dadosGravados = json_decode(file_get_contents($nomeArquivo), true);
$arquivo = fopen($nomeArquivo, 'w');

// Incrementa as informações enviadas com o que já havia gravado
array_push($dadosGravados, $dados);

if (fwrite($arquivo, json_encode($dadosGravados))) {
resposta(200, "Requisição realizada com sucesso!", $dados);
} else {
resposta(300, "Falha ao salvar os dados da requisição.", $dados);
}

fclose($arquivo);
}

function requisicao($metodo, $body, $parametros)
{
switch ($metodo) {
case 'POST':
salvar($body);
break;
case 'GET':
resposta(200, "Requisição realizada com sucesso!", $body);
break;
}
}

// Obtém o método HTTP, body e parâmetros da requisição
$metodo = $_SERVER['REQUEST_METHOD'];
$parametros = explode('/', trim($_SERVER['REQUEST_URI'], '/'));
$body = json_decode(file_get_contents('php://input'), true);

try {
requisicao($metodo, $body, $parametros);
} catch (Exception $e) {
resposta(400, $e->getMessage(), $e);
}

# pix
Avatar discord do usuario marcosvinicius0759

marcosvinicius0759

mas para nodejs

# cartões
Avatar discord do usuario victorviana_

victorviana_

Ver Respostas

Olá, como você conseguiu gerar o token com reactjs?

# cartões
Avatar discord do usuario marcelocaser

marcelocaser

Ver Respostas

Sim.. com reactjs…

# freelancer
Avatar discord do usuario ferks1234q

ferks1234q

js

# devs
Avatar discord do usuario henryq_

henryq_

socket hang up <- Alguém ja teve este problema quando tenta fazer autênticação utilizando NodeJS

# pix
Avatar discord do usuario _ivopereira

_ivopereira

Ver Respostas

alguem pode me ajudar com isso estou tentnando enviar pix pela api

jsx
data: {
nome: 'erro_autorizacao',
mensagem: 'Para ativar este serviço, envie um e-mail para [email protected] ou abra um ticket em sua conta Efí'
}